Fillies Trample Lady Tigers, 11-4
From the Apr 14, 2026 e-EditionWAVERLY (April 7) — The Huntingdon High School Fillies traveled to Waverly Central Tuesday for a district softball contest. An early lead and a big sixth inning sealed an 11-4 win for the Fillies.
Huntingdon set the tone with two runs in the top of the first frame, then added two more in the second. Waverly got on the board with a run in the bottom of the fourth. The Fillies plated one in the fifth, then erupted for five in the top of the sixth. The Lady Tigers managed three in the home half. Huntingdon tacked on a run in the seventh.
Huntingdon's Camdyn Sellers was 2-for-5 with a home run, three RBIs and a run scored. Knox Bennett was 2-for-4 with two doubles, a walk, an RBI, two runs scored and a stolen base. Kylie Tippitt was 3-for-5 with two RBIs. Gracey Martin was 2-for-3 with a walk, an RBI, two runs scored and three stolen bases. Emalynn Maness was 1-for-3 with a sacrifice fly, two RBIs and a run scored. Millie Luther was 1-for-5 with a double and two runs scored. Aubry Castleman was 1-for-4 with a walk, an RBI, a run scored and a stolen base. Ellie Wilson was 1-for-4 with a walk and a run scored. Grier Bartholomew was 0-for-1 with three walks, a run scored and a stolen base.
Lady Tiger Abigail White was 2-for-3 with a walk and a run scored. Carley McKlemurry was 1-for-4 with two runs scored and a stolen base. Marley Bissinger was 1-for-3 with an RBI. McKenzie Elmore and Major Daniels were each 1-for-3.
Marcie Mitchell earned the complete-game victory for the Fillies, allowing four runs (three earned) on six hits while walking two and striking out three.
Ashton Cash took the loss for Waverly, allowing four runs (two earned) on five hits while walking one and striking out one in an inning and a third. McKenzie Elmore pitched five and two-thirds innings of relief, allowing seven runs (two earned) on eight hits while walking six and striking out four.
